The short answer

On the numbers, Dubai works out roughly 25% cheaper per month than Singapore once rent and everyday costs are added up. Singapore is the softer landing day-to-day since English is the working language, while Dubai rewards picking up Arabic. Both have full set-up guides below, so the real choice comes down to climate, career field, and the lifestyle you're after.

Language, region & climate

🇦🇪

Dubai

Arabic
Day-to-day life rewards some Arabic.
Middle East
GMT+4 · AED
Climate
Hot desert — extreme summer heat and humidity, glorious Nov–Mar winters.
🇸🇬

Singapore

English
English is the working language — an easy landing.
Southeast Asia
GMT+8 · SGD
Climate
Equatorial — hot, humid and rainy all year; no real seasons.

Which is better for…

Your budget

Dubai (~25% cheaper)

Dubai stretches your salary further — lower combined rent and living costs by our estimate. Singapore runs pricier.

Your career

Singapore

Singapore's English-first workplace makes switching jobs and networking easier for most internationals. Dubai: Real estate & construction, Finance & fintech, Aviation & logistics. Singapore: Finance & Wealth Management, Technology (APAC HQs), Biotech & Pharma.
